답변

1

당신은 내가 그나마 다음을 시도해 볼 수도 있습니다 이 솔루션과 같지만 새로운 select2를 만들면 작동합니다.

$button.click(function() { 
    $('#select').select2('destroy').empty().select2({allowClear: true, 
    placeholder: 'Placeholder...'}); 
}); 
+0

'을 추가해야합니다. '데이터'를 설정하기 전에'.empty()'를 추가해 주셔서 감사합니다! – Unirgy

1

다음과 같은 버튼을 클릭 이벤트를 업데이트하십시오 내가 internets에서 발견 한 방법 ...,

$button.click(function() { 
    $select.empty(); 
}); 
+0

선택을 취소하려고하지 않습니다. 나는 옵션 – Unirgy

+0

을 지우려고하는데 이것은 전체 select2를 지우고 Op는 플레이스 홀더와 같은 모든 것을 다시 식별해야합니다. 그는 데이터 만 업데이트하면됩니다. – Jacky

+0

선택한 옵션 만 제거된다는 의미입니까? – prathmeshb1